So yeah – belated birthday present.  I’ve had the gift sitting on my craft table for a while now.  I knew I was going to put it in one of my bags from the shoppe.  And then when I went to package it, uh, it was too big.  Awesome.  So I grabbed this remnant piece of muslin that I had and wrapped it around the gift, and then embellished away.  I’m not a huge user of Imaginisce products, but I simply could not resist their new Animal Crackers collection.  So bright, so fun, so colorful. 

CircusPresent1

I added a little music note patterned rubon from Glitz Design on to my lil’ taggie, and then a Glitzer (transparent sticker) and some teeny alpha stickers from Glitz too.

CircusPresent2

Cute canvas tag stickers in the Animal Crackers collection too; I love topping party hats with a pom pom.

CircusPresent3

I mixed in some pennant stickers from Jenni Bowlin and a sticker strip and some chipboard from My Mind’s Eye.
